Pradeep published the artcileFluorine substituted thiomethyl pyrimidine derivatives as efficient inhibitors for mild steel corrosion in hydrochloric acid solution: Thermodynamic, electrochemical and DFT studies, COA of Formula: C10H20N2O2, the main research area is fluorine substituted thiomethyl pyrimidine derivative steel corrosion inhibitor thermodn.

Three new 5-fluoro-2- methylthio substituted pyrimidine derivatives have been synthesized and characterized by 1H NMR spectroscopy and Mass spectrometry. Corrosion inhibition characteristics of the synthesized pyrimidine derivatives have been studied on mild steel (MS) in 0.5 M hydrochloric acid solution at various temperatures (303-333 K) using mass loss and electrochem. techniques. The obtained weight loss, electrochem. impedance and potentiodynamic polarization data indicate that the corrosion inhibition efficiency is directly proportional to concentration of the inhibitors. The Adsorption process on MS surface obeyed Langmuir isotherm model. SEM (SEM) was used to characterize surface morphol. of the MS specimen in absence and presence of pyrimidine derivatives D. functional theory (DFT) calculations using B3LYP functional with 6-311+G (d,p) level was used to establish the relationship between mol. structure and corrosion inhibition efficiency. Electrochem. anal. indicated that pyrimidine derivatives inhibit the corrosion by adsorbing on the metal surface. Mixed-type of corrosion inhibition activity with anodic predominance was proposed by polarization studies.
